You are currently viewing Consensus mechanism in cryptocurrency explained

Consensus mechanism in cryptocurrency explained

Consensus mechanism is considered to be a vital part in all cryptocurrencies.

And that’s because it’s responsible to make sure that the data stored inside the blockchain are reliable and completely accurate.

This means that without it, cryptocurrencies wouldn’t be able to function as money and their value will be zero!

So, what exactly is this mechanism and how does it work in order to allow cryptocurrencies to run?

Consensus mechanism is an algorithm used to ensure that the data from every financial transaction are secure and accurate and this is what gives value to cryptocurrencies.

At this point it is becoming pretty obvious that when someone wants to invest in cryptocurrency it is a necessity to learn and understand the idea behind the consensus mechanism.

But you shouldn’t worry because this post is not getting technical at all.

On the contrary, highlights the key points you need in order to understand such a complex concept with very little effort!

If you wish to take a more thorough look about consensus algorithms you should read about the Proof of Work and Proof of Stake which are the best consensus algorithms right now.

Consensus mechanism in cryptocurrency explained

Cryptocurrencies are records of transactions which are kept in the form of digital data.

This also happens in the case of banks, in which payment records on bank accounts can play the role of a currency, which is called a deposit currency.

As a result, digital data are able to be considered currencies if the records meet the necessary condition to be accurate and reliable.

In case of deposit currency, the accuracy and reliability comes centrally by the bank.

Many bank employees dedicate a significant amount of time and effort just to maintain the integrity of transaction records and that’s why those records can be trusted.

On the other side, cryptocurrencies keep the integrity of those records using a computer mechanism.

This mechanism involves a large number of people in a decentralized manner and is running on the internet.

The difficulty in this case lies in how to keep payment/receipt records between accounts, how to link one account to another and how all that digital data will stay secure, accurate and reliable.

Blockchain technology makes this possible by utilizing an algorithm which is called consensus mechanism or consensus algorithm.

But how does consensus mechanism assure that the data are reliable?

The digital data is kept in many different and independent computers throughout the world.

Every one of those computers keeps the full record of transactions.

If all those computers are able to be in consensus with each other, then there is no doubt that their data will be accurate since we are talking about thousands of computers.

Now, if there is a problem in which a computer has different data than all the others, then the other computers will come to a consensus and will prove that the computer that has different data is wrong.

The way in which the computers come into consensus depends on the different architectures that every cryptocurrency choses to use.

What are different types of consensus mechanisms?

In blockchain networks the two most prevalent mechanisms to come in consensus are the Proof of Work and Proof of Stake.

In Proof of Work, the algorithm that operates the system rewards miners (the computers) who solve mathematical problems.

When new transactions happen, their data is sent from the crypto wallets to all the computers on the network.

Some of the cryptocurrencies that use this algorithm are: Bitcoin, Dogecoin, Litecoin and many others.

If you want to learn more about Proof of Work click here.

In Proof of Stake, the consensus algorithm is based on owning cryptos in the network.

In Proof of Stake architecture, the creator of a new block is chosen by some criteria, like the total coins owned, the period of time someone participates on the network etc.

Some of the most famous crypto using Proof of Stake is the Ethereum 2.0, the MATIC (Polygon), Solana and Cardano.

If you want to learn more about Proof of Stake click here and here.

Why do we need different consensus mechanisms?

This is a very good question that has a reasonable answer.

This is happening because every consensus mechanism has its advantages and disadvantages.

Proof of Work, which was the first consensus mechanism ever used in crypto, is considered to be very secure and also has already been proven that works fine at large scale.

On the contrary, the supporters of Proof of Stake, which by the way is relatively new in the cryptocurrency environment, support it because speeds up the transactions process and at the same time is planet friendly.

Which is the best consensus mechanism?

Proof of Work is at this moment the most used consensus mechanism by cryptocurrencies.

However, there are some drawbacks to it and that’s why people are experimenting with different types of consensus algorithms.

As mentioned above, we haven’t yet seen the capabilities that Proof of Stake has to offer since it hasn’t been tested in every possible situation.

As a result we can say that it is not possible to know at this moment which consensus mechanism is the best, since the cryptocurrency technology itself is yet on a premature level.

So we just have to wait and see if one will prevail or not.

Conclusion

Consensus mechanism is considered to be the backbone of any cryptocurrency.

And this is happening because it completes the gaps needed in order for any cryptocurrency to be able to be used as money.

Image source: Jorge Franganillo